August 14th, 1970
The Hump, Marco Polo Resort Hotel - Miami, FL
1. Back Door Man
2. Rock Me
3. Fever
4. I'm A Man
Recordings: None Known
NOTES: While on trial in Miami, Jim attends a Canned Heat Concert at the Hump and is
asked to sit in by the band.

Friday, December 12th, 1970
The Warehouse - New Orleans, LA
1. Soul Kitchen
2. Break On Through
3. Light My Fire
Recordings: None Known
NOTES: Last Doors show with Jim - he appears ill during performance; Setlist incomplete.
